Served as the 48th President of the Dominican Republic from 1982 to 1986. Focused on economic reforms and modernization during the presidency. Oversaw significant events in the country’s political landscape during the 1980s. His administration faced challenges related to debt and economic stability, which led to political tensions. After leaving office, faced legal issues related to corruption allegations.

Played as a pitcher for the Cincinnati Reds and the Chicago White Sox during a career spanning from 1958 to 1966. Achieved recognition for outstanding performance in the 1963 season, leading the National League in earned run average (ERA) with a remarkable 2.57. Selected for the All-Star team in 1964, further showcasing pitching skills at the highest level in Major League Baseball. Concluded career with a record of 89 wins and 77 losses over his time in the league.
